<div dir="ltr">It'll be great to have ITM replaced. I know I've been talking about this for more than a decade, but I still like the idea of an item having multiple equipment records, so that it can have different stats in different equip slots, or when equipped by different heroes, or dependent on tags, so just wanted to suggest designing the reload format around that kind of future extension.<br></div><br><div class="gmail_quote gmail_quote_container"><div dir="ltr" class="gmail_attr">On Fri, 27 Jun 2025 at 22:30, James Paige <<a href="mailto:Bob@hamsterrepublic.com">Bob@hamsterrepublic.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="auto">Yes, I want to fix up the item editor, and I am working towards replacing ITM format with items.reld so it will be easier to add item features. I'm also going to enable longer item descriptions</div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Fri, Jun 27, 2025, 2:02 AM Ralph Versteegen via Ohrrpgce <<a href="mailto:ohrrpgce@lists.motherhamster.org" target="_blank">ohrrpgce@lists.motherhamster.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">It's wonderful to almost be rid of itembuf() code! That was some of the ugliest around. Off the top of my head, I think that aside from the item/enemy/attack editors, only a little bit of code touching gmap() still uses magic indices. Are you going to refactor the item editor now?<br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Thu, 26 Jun 2025 at 12:21, cron--- via Ohrrpgce <<a href="mailto:ohrrpgce@lists.motherhamster.org" rel="noreferrer" target="_blank">ohrrpgce@lists.motherhamster.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><a href="https://github.com/ohrrpgce/ohrrpgce/commit/34590426d40602f87958392c3cf59d490fd71631" rel="noreferrer noreferrer" target="_blank">https://github.com/ohrrpgce/ohrrpgce/commit/34590426d40602f87958392c3cf59d490fd71631</a><br>
Author: james <james@7d344553-34f0-0310-a9b1-970ce8f1c3a2><br>
Date:   Thu Jun 26 00:15:33 2025 +0000<br>
<br>
    Add a saveitemdata overload that converts ItemDef back into ITM formatted itembuf()<br>
<br>
<br>
 <a href="http://loading.bi" rel="noreferrer noreferrer" target="_blank">loading.bi</a>   |  3 ++-<br>
 loading.rbas | 59 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++<br>
 2 files changed, 61 insertions(+), 1 deletion(-)<br>
<br>
<br>
<br>
_______________________________________________<br>
Ohrrpgce mailing list<br>
<a href="mailto:ohrrpgce@lists.motherhamster.org" rel="noreferrer" target="_blank">ohrrpgce@lists.motherhamster.org</a><br>
<a href="http://lists.motherhamster.org/listinfo.cgi/ohrrpgce-motherhamster.org" rel="noreferrer noreferrer" target="_blank">http://lists.motherhamster.org/listinfo.cgi/ohrrpgce-motherhamster.org</a><br>
</blockquote></div>
_______________________________________________<br>
Ohrrpgce mailing list<br>
<a href="mailto:ohrrpgce@lists.motherhamster.org" rel="noreferrer" target="_blank">ohrrpgce@lists.motherhamster.org</a><br>
<a href="http://lists.motherhamster.org/listinfo.cgi/ohrrpgce-motherhamster.org" rel="noreferrer noreferrer" target="_blank">http://lists.motherhamster.org/listinfo.cgi/ohrrpgce-motherhamster.org</a><br>
</blockquote></div>
</blockquote></div>